Position Summary

Under moderate supervision, provides support of desktop computer systems and other technology-based systems for University staff, faculty and students. Desktop support provides technical support for computer operating systems, software, hardware and networking. This level requires a broad understanding of all standard enterprise office technologies to effectively support customer technical needs. This is a Tier 1 high volume call center position.

Primary duties & Responsibilities

  • Project Facilitation: Completes tasks associated with projects or activities that relate to the desktop support environment, such as system upgrades, system integration and system administration.
  • Service Desk: Collaborates with higher level technical areas on planning and issue resolution. Prioritizes work load to appropriately respond to customer needs and demands. Acts as a liaison between customers and senior technical staff.
  • Desktop Support: Provides daily support for the computing desktop including operating system, software installation and maintenance and hardware. Responds to assigned tickets. Evaluates, prioritizes, resolves problems and requests or escalates to appropriate support areas. Acts as the front-facing support liaison for all desktop-related support issues. Provides support documentation for Tier 1.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Working Conditions

Ability to work on call; ability to travel to on- and off-campus locations.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Ability to understand, be accountable and complete assigned tasks associated with projects such as system upgrades, system integration and system administration.
  • Degree in a field of study with desktop support experience in an enterprise environment.
  • Strong customer service skills, including written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to prioritize work load to appropriately respond to customer needs and demands.
  • Experience supporting all standard office productivity applications and computing platforms in an enterprise environment.

Required Qualifications

High school diploma or equivalent high school certification plus two years of desktop support in an enterprise environment,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
